What are some of the factors that I should consider when selecting a Excavator?

Project Requirements: Assess your project’s specific needs, including the size of the excavations, and any special requirements, such as reach or depth limitations and if GPS software is required.

Size and Capacity: Choose an excavator size and capacity that aligns with the scale and scope of your project. Consider factors such as access constraints, working space, and the volume of material to be excavated.

Rental Duration: Determine the duration for which you’ll need the excavator. Rental rates often vary based on the rental period, so optimizing the rental duration can help minimize costs.

Availability: Ask for the availability of excavator rentals, Consider booking in advance, especially during peak construction seasons, to secure the necessary equipment.

Rental Rates: Get rental rates and terms specific to your job site to ensure you get the best value. Consider factors such as the hours needed per period and daily, weekly, monthly, or seasonal monthly rates.

Attachments and Accessories: Determine if any specific attachments or accessories are required for your project, such as specific buckets, hydraulic hammers, thumbs, or rippers.

Delivery and Pickup: Coordinate logistics for the rental excavator’s delivery and pickup to your project site. Confirm delivery times and site-specific requirements, such as access restrictions or permits.

Operator Training and Support: Ensure that operators are properly trained and familiar with operating the rental excavator. Our rental representatives offer operator training or support services to help you maximize productivity and safety.

Insurance Coverage: Ask about coverage for the equipment that is to be rented. Ensure that the coverage is adequate to protect against potential damages or liabilities during the rental period.

By considering these factors, you can select a rental excavator that meets your project needs while staying within budget and ensuring smooth operations on-site.
